Austin el is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Edinburg, Hidalgo County. The school has 356 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Maria Lopez. It is part of the Edinburg Cisd school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5 in an urban setting. The school employs 32.5 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 11.0:1. 32% of students are proficient in reading. 22% are proficient in maths. Austin el enrolls 356 students across grades Pre-Kโ5. The student body is 49% male and 51% female. A teaching staff of 32.5 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 11.0: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 99% Hispanic or Latino and <1% White.

325 of the school's 356 students (91%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 317 qualify for free lunch and 8 for a reduced price.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Austin el is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Midsize).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. Austin el is one of 46 schools in EDINBURG CISD, based in EDINBURG, Texas. The district serves 33,343 students district-wide and employs 2,305 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 356 students, Austin el is smaller than the district average of about 725 students per school.
